There is really no way to have the timing off that much. Align the pully marks, aligth the dot on the CAS and stab it making sure you 'center' where the set screw goes in. Deflood it, and make sure your plugs are clean and dry. Foot on the throttle and crank it. Once/if it fires up, play with the throttle to keep it alive. If you take your foot off the pedal and it dies, it prolly has a major vacuum leak somewhere.

I broke my UIM at the flange, kinda inverse of what you have and I just had a machine shop weld it for me. It cost 60 bux but that's prolly cheeper than buying a used one. I wouldn't trust jb at all for that, it's more of a metal filler than anything.
